There are pros and cons with a fixed rate mortgage versus an adjustable rate mortgage (ARM), especially for first time homebuyers. The low initial cost of adjustable-rate mortgages, or ARMs, can be very tempting to home buyers, yet they carry a degree of uncertainty. Fixed-rate mortgages offer rate and payment security, but they can be more expensive.
